
The Work Life Balance at Bluebeam is rated a B by 30 employees putting it in the Top 30% of similar size companies on Comparably. 80% of Bluebeam employees are satisfied with their work life balance while 75% feel they are burnt out. A well proportioned work life balance is necessary to keep employees happy and productive.
About 80% of the employees at Bluebeam work eight hours or less, while 3% of them have a very long day - longer than twelve hours. The Majority of Bluebeam employees are satisfied with their work life balance and feel burnt out.
In general, employees who have been at the company 1 to 2 Years and employees in the Marketing department believe they have good work life balance while employees with 3 to 6 Years experience and Male employees think there is room for improvement.
